Résumé :
Like playing sports and other games of skill, practicing math can be an exhilarating way of sharpening your mind. Conscious Math is a guide to spark your curiosity and record inspired insights. People learn math best when they can make their own discoveries, connecting dots of information and creating their own constellations of knowledge. This book offers visual cues and a coherent mental framework for uniting galaxies of constellations into a single, more accessible universe. It is designed to spark those light-bulb moments when things suddenly make sense. As you brighten each page with the light of your attention and flashes of discovery, the book becomes a string of colored lights for you to open and re-illuminate whenever you wish to remember.
All too often, learning math is treated as a matter of memorizing one piece of information after another. These pieces of information can seem random and unconnected, making math frustrating and confusing.
Practicing math consciously means working to understand a larger framework, conceptualizing new pieces of information as components of a system. Conscious Math involves zooming in on small details, and zooming out to look for patterns within a bigger picture. It means asking ourselves questions to focus our unconscious memories and skills on one task at a time. Conscious Math is mindful and creative.
This book condenses math instruction to help frame that bigger picture. It draws together essential elements of algebra, geometry, trigonometry, and basic calculus, combining already familiar material with accessible introductions to more advanced topics for students at almost every level. Conscious Math is a valuable guide for developing new skills while consolidating old ones. It is suitable for all students grades 6 through 12, especially those looking for more creative and engaging approaches to learning math. The artful notes and exercises are also good for collecting and rekindling past knowledge in time for college calculus courses or big tests, just for fun, or for sharing math with other people.
Biographie:
Nathan has developed his ideas about teaching and learning mathematics through more than 20 years of experience as a professional tutor, since graduating from Stanford University in 1997. He has helped students attending the most competitive schools in Silicon Valley, as well as college students and homeschooled children. Students have been amazed at their increased understanding and confidence, reflected in their improved grades and test scores.
